Tarka contains two different types of medicines:

  • a calcium channel blocker (verapamil)
  • an Angiotensin Converting Enzyme (ACE) inhibitor (trandolapril)

First of all, this is not a cholesterol lowering drug. It is a very potent antihypertensive that as the poster above says, contains 2 different drugs in combination, one of which is not approved for use in Thailand.

So, no way to get it here.

Does nto appear to be available in Malaysia, Hong Kong or Singapore either.
